Cost of Living FAQs

Is it cheaper to rent or buy in Wheatley Heights?

Based on median housing data, renting is currently more affordable on a monthly basis in Wheatley Heights. The estimated all-in monthly cost for renting is $2,396, while owning a median-priced home with a 20% down payment is roughly $4,032 per month (a difference of $1,636).

How much do utilities cost in Wheatley Heights?

The average monthly utility cost (electricity and natural gas) for a typical home in Wheatley Heights is approximately $248. This estimate uses local utility rate schedules combined with median energy consumption profiles.

What is a good salary to live comfortably in Wheatley Heights?

To comfortably afford the median rent and utilities in Wheatley Heights without exceeding the recommended 30% housing-to-income threshold, a household should earn a gross salary of approximately $95,840 per year.
